Ingredients for - Moroccan-Inspired Meatloaf

1. Olive oil 2 tablespoons
2. Yellow onion, chopped 1 medium
3. Carrot, peeled and chopped 1 large
4. Celery, chopped 1 large stalk
5. Garlic, chopped 6 cloves
6. Fresh ginger, minced 1 (3 inch) piece
7. Kosher salt 1 ¼ teaspoons
8. Sweet paprika 1 teaspoon
9. Ground cumin 1 teaspoon
10. Curry powder 1 teaspoon
11. Cayenne pepper ¼ teaspoon
12. Ground cinnamon ¼ teaspoon
13. Freshly ground black pepper ¼ teaspoon
14. Ground lamb 2 pounds
15. Ground beef 1 pound
16. Dry bread crumbs 1 ¼ cups
17. Chopped fresh cilantro ¼ cup
18. Eggs 2 large
19. Chopped fresh mint 2 tablespoons
20. Ketchup 1 ½ cups
21. Yellow onion, minced ¼ medium
22. Pomegranate molasses 1 tablespoon
23. 1/2 medium chipotle pepper in adobo sauce, minced 1 tablespoon
24. Adobo sauce from chipotle peppers 1 ½ teaspoons
25. White sugar ½ teaspoon

How to cook deliciously - Moroccan-Inspired Meatloaf

1 . Stage

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).

2 . Stage

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add onion, carrot, celery, garlic, and ginger; cook until onion is translucent, about 5 minutes. Stir in salt, paprika, cumin, curry powder, cayenne, cinnamon, and black pepper and cook to release flavors, 1 to 2 minutes. Remove from the heat and let cool for 10 to 15 minutes.

3 . Stage

Combine the lamb and beef in a large bowl. Add cooled vegetable mixture and stir to combine. Mix in bread crumbs, cilantro, eggs, and mint.

4 . Stage

Transfer meatloaf mixture to a 1 1/2-quart loaf pan and set in a baking pan. Pour water in the baking pan to reach halfway up the sides of the loaf pan.

5 . Stage

Bake in the preheated oven until firm and cooked through, about 1 1/2 hours. An instant-read thermometer inserted into the center should read at least 160 degrees F (70 degrees C). Remove from the oven and let rest for 10 to 15 minutes.

6 . Stage

Meanwhile, prepare the BBQ sauce, if using. Combine ketchup, onion, molasses, chipotle pepper, adobo sauce, and sugar in a small saucepan over low heat; bring to a simmer. Cook until flavors blend, about 5 minutes. Remove from heat and let cool to room temperature.

7 . Stage

Unmold meatloaf onto a large plate. Slice and serve with the sauce.
